The tribes are one of the socially excluded groups living in our country. The total population of tribal people in the country accounts for about 8.9% of the total population. The Tribal population in Tamil Nadu accounts for 7,94,697 and constitutes 1.1 per cent of the population of the state according to the 2011 census. There are totally 36 different tribal groups live in the state and in which six of them are termed as Particularly Vulnerable Tribal groups (PVTG's) by the government with the purpose of enabling improvement in the conditions of life of people particularly those at low development indices. The Irula tribe, indigenous to Tamil Nadu, represents a unique cultural group with rich traditions and knowledge systems. This study presents an ethnographic assessment of the Irula community in the Coimbatore district, focusing on their social structures, belief systems, livelihood strategies, and the impact of modernization on their cultural practices. Utilizing qualitative methods such as participant observation and in-depth interviews, the research uncovers the dynamic interplay between tradition and change within the Irula society. The findings highlight the community's resilience and adaptability, emphasizing the need for culturally sensitive development policies that respect and integrate indigenous knowledge systems.

Recognition of respiratory conditions at the right time remains fundamental to deliver both proper treatment and superior patient results. Standard auscultation techniques face two significant problems due to subjective evaluation of patients' airway sounds and inconsistent interpreter interpretations. The system presents a real-time intelligent phonopulmography system with acoustic sensing capabilities to automate the precise classification of lung sounds. The system uses special hardware components built from a combination of stethoscope along with microphone and operational amplifier circuits connected to an Arduino to detect and improve respiratory audio signals. Through MATLAB processing the acquired sounds become structured data that can be classified using methods such as Mel-frequency cepstral coefficients and spectral analysis during feature extraction. A deep learning-based version of the convolutional neural network runs in Python using TensorFlow to classify lung sounds into the categories of normal along with crackles, wheezes and rhonchi. A pre-trained feature extractor enables performance improvement in the system. The model processed 3,680 clinically marked audio samples to reach more than 90% successful classifications. Modern usability features of the web interface allow real-time audio recording with automatic diagnostic assessment following AI model processing. The research demonstrates how coupled sensing hardware with AI methods accomplishes real-time respiratory evaluation that is both reliable and scalable. Upcoming developmental goals target the expansion of the database as well as the improvement of response speeds for future mobile and cloud-based remote healthcare applications.

Abstract: This study has been undertaken to evaluate the thermodynamic properties such as enthalpy, specific heat, and SMER were calculated. The results showed that the drying behaviour of Capsicum Annum was best described by the tray dryer at all temperatures. The thermodynamic properties results indicated that the drying process was spontaneous and exothermic, and the SMER decreased during the process. It was found that the specific heat capacity and enthalpy decreased as moisture content decreased, while energy consumption increased. Understanding the drying behaviour of Capsicum Annum and the involved thermodynamic properties can help in designing efficient drying processes that can preserve the quality of the product.

In the internet shopping scenario, buyer behaviour is affected by a plethora of factors, including buyer trust, privacy concerns and perceived risk. Online retail (e-retail) is quite evidently growing at a fast pace, and the degree of online purchase is humongous. However due to complex market scenario intense competition and ever-changing consumer dynamics, sustainability is sceptical. Hence e-tailers are extremely focused on the loyalty aspect of buyers. Thus, it is pivotal for marketers to identify those factors that foster e-retail patronage behaviour amongst online buyers, specifically generation Z. Demographically more than 50% of India's population is below the age of 25. Therefore, the study is focused on individuals belonging to that age group. The objective of this research is to explore those factors of an e-retail stores that are pivotal in developing a sense of loyalty among Generation Z consumers. This study explores the patronage behaviour of Generation Z consumers by focusing on three key variables: e-store atmospherics, e-service quality, and e-merchandise, in relation to their patronage intentions. Data was gathered through a structured questionnaire. The findings identified additional significant factors influencing patronage behaviour. The outcome revealed that e-merchandise showed a negative association with e-patronage intentions, whereas both e-service quality and e-store atmospherics were found to have a positive impact on Generation Z's online patronage behaviour.

The primary responsibility of the State is to ensure the fair and impartial administration of justice, making it accessible to all citizens, irrespective of socio-economic status. In India, this responsibility is upheld through judicial independence, but procedural delays and jurisdictional limitations hinder timely access to justice. One key aspect of the judicial system, writ jurisdiction under Article 32 of the Indian Constitution, plays a crucial role in protecting citizens' fundamental rights, particularly against violations by the State. However, the current framework of writ jurisdiction faces significant barriers in terms of accessibility, particularly for marginalized communities. This research examines the challenges faced by Indian citizens due to the absence of writ jurisdiction at lower judicial levels, and the urgent need for the implementation of Article 32(3), which empowers Parliament to authorize other courts, such as High Courts, to issue writs. While Article 32 allows citizens to directly approach the Supreme Court for the enforcement of fundamental rights, its practical effectiveness is limited by factors such as legal illiteracy, financial constraints, and bureaucratic delays. These barriers disproportionately affect vulnerable populations, leaving them without effective legal recourse. The study critically analyzes the systemic issues in accessing justice, especially in rural and economically disadvantaged areas, and highlights how the lack of writ jurisdiction at lower levels exacerbates these challenges. The research proposes the expansion of writ jurisdiction under Article 32(3) as a solution to improve access to justice.

The study investigates the causes and impacts of job stress in construction workers, one of the most challenging industries because of unsafe working conditions, long working hours, illness, and intra-organizational conflict. The study used a mixed-method, Structural Equation Modeling (SEM) for examining relations between major stressors--risky work environment, overtime, health issues, and workplace conflicts--and Logistic Regression to categorize workers according to levels of stress. Information from 205 employees, comprising laborers, supervisors, and engineers, showed that workplace conflicts had the most significant positive effect on stress, and overtime, which was found to have a negative correlation, implying that paid overtime might reduce stress since it is voluntary and well-compensated which gives financial relief. Married and older employees were discovered to experience lower levels of stress. The results highlight the importance of managing workplace conflicts and improving employee well-being in the construction sector.

The Smart Rainwater Harvesting System makes use of modern technology for capturing and collecting rainwater. The system leads to better and longer-term water management by incorporating IoT-based tools and interrogating domain-tested approaches. The system is operated by an Arduino Uno, which serves as the central processing unit of the system. The control unit connects to different functional sensors; ultrasonic sensors determine the level of the water in the tank, pH sensors determine if the water is safe, and rain sensors enable the system to be activated automatically when it is raining. The optimization of operations requires a minimum amount of manual work to be done. The system implements actuators and servo motors which automatically turn open and close valves. The components responsive to the sensors regulate the different actions wherein water can either be collected, filtered, stored, or sent to where it is required. The sensors transmit all the information to the cloud in a real-time-stream, enabling users to monitor the system with a mobile app from any place. Users can check the devices whether they are at home, at work, or on a trip, and they will be able to make the necessary modifications from their mobile devices. The simulations on Tinkercad provided adequate hope concerning the outcomes and as such, prototypes were built and tested. Testing proved that the system could autonomously collect water, check its quality, and manage its distribution in an efficient self-regulating manner. The system relies on solar power to further enhance sustainability. This feature eliminates dependence on the electric grid, making it very useful for remote locations with limited or no access to electricity. The SRHS has been tailored to be low-cost, with simple structural modifications, and considered 'green technology'. Whether deployed within residential units, commercial structures, or agricultural land, the invention provides an innovative solution aimed at mitigating the worrisome problem of water deficit on a global scale.
